Coppell – Participates with Sack Summer Hunger
Assistance League of Coppell was pleased to donate $5,000 to Sack Summer Hunger, a program sponsored in Coppell by Metrocrest Services and Coppell Cares. The program distributes easy-to-prepare, kid-friendly meals and snacks to families in Coppell who qualify for free or reduced-rate lunches during the school year. Pasadena – 80-year-old Charity Delivers Fun-care Packages to Local Essential Workers
Assistance League of Pasadena has joined with seven women-owned businesses to distribute “fun” care packages to local essential workers. Items have included everything from key chains to tote bags, socks, banners, and coasters, among others entertaining items. Chicagoland West – Meets Community Needs During COVID
Assistance League Chicagoland West volunteers provided personal care items, activity packets and school supplies to support struggling families during the COVID-19 pandemic. Answering the question “What can we do to help?”, volunteers worked closely with agencies and schools throughout the area, identifying needs that could not be met through regular support channels.
